bitcreditscc (OP)
|
|
November 22, 2015, 08:21:48 AM |
|
here is a useful hint for people bidding and change addresses in a bitcoin client.
each time i send from my btc client, I dump the address i send from's privkey and import it into BCR with a label of bid date. so the address i get paid to in BCR shows up under inputs as bid1115 for nov 15th. since bitcoin uses change addresses any other coins in my bitcoin wallet from that input end up in a new address whose privkey i havent dumped or exposed
Since you are on github and have access, please open an issue there that i can track and come back to during coding. Already i've cleaned up the bidpage so adding additional stuff is not that hard. As for the other requests , let's list them as milestones on the git and we can pursue them. Though...you do know that each new feature request == more code, more time, more delays , more study and more potential bugs.... so don't be too surprised if I push the rc further.
|
|
|
|
hack_
|
|
November 22, 2015, 05:53:22 PM |
|
here is a useful hint for people bidding and change addresses in a bitcoin client.
each time i send from my btc client, I dump the address i send from's privkey and import it into BCR with a label of bid date. so the address i get paid to in BCR shows up under inputs as bid1115 for nov 15th. since bitcoin uses change addresses any other coins in my bitcoin wallet from that input end up in a new address whose privkey i havent dumped or exposed
Since you are on github and have access, please open an issue there that i can track and come back to during coding. Already i've cleaned up the bidpage so adding additional stuff is not that hard. As for the other requests , let's list them as milestones on the git and we can pursue them. Though...you do know that each new feature request == more code, more time, more delays , more study and more potential bugs.... so don't be too surprised if I push the rc further. Let's just do what we can without too many delays. I'd like us to start the year with at least one working p2p service publicly released.
|
|
|
|
jasemoney
Legendary
Offline
Activity: 1610
Merit: 1008
Forget-about-it
|
|
November 22, 2015, 08:01:04 PM Last edit: November 22, 2015, 09:04:38 PM by jasemoney |
|
here is a useful hint for people bidding and change addresses in a bitcoin client.
each time i send from my btc client, I dump the address i send from's privkey and import it into BCR with a label of bid date. so the address i get paid to in BCR shows up under inputs as bid1115 for nov 15th. since bitcoin uses change addresses any other coins in my bitcoin wallet from that input end up in a new address whose privkey i havent dumped or exposed
Since you are on github and have access, please open an issue there that i can track and come back to during coding. Already i've cleaned up the bidpage so adding additional stuff is not that hard. As for the other requests , let's list them as milestones on the git and we can pursue them. Though...you do know that each new feature request == more code, more time, more delays , more study and more potential bugs.... so don't be too surprised if I push the rc further. Let's just do what we can without too many delays. I'd like us to start the year with at least one working p2p service publicly released. this is just an operations "best practice" suggestion, no code required. looking for clarity on voting. Adding: ended up on a fork an hour and 20 min ago, block height 251738, chains shows block hash 001208333b6ca7e1ca9955825f3dac3ac5bebbdd210fe262e70f27a167f02a4b wallet shows hash 0002ff305d9536c02cd593464331b08241bfaa7262693797bb83191674eea71b instead of just getting stuck at invalid block like normal though my wallet is synced at block height 251795 hash 0002d8bd600d7e309ab3f0283973c6de4770b3b552f8210a4595035e0d065129 chainz 251795 hash 0003f7fc0224905770b7eff53169a5d5c75f5de43bb0ff95ebfaf92ffdf9bfd8 anyways this is a proper fork, it split 60 blocks ago and both sides are mining. and block height is within 1 block (im not currently mining nor have i been) Anyways I'm connected to 91.230.123.101:8888 version 0.30.17.8/, im the same version. I will be deleting and re-syncing. I suggest whoever is 91.230.123.101:8888 do the same, and maybe someone upload a bootstrap from the same chain that the explorer is on. while re-syncing I connect to 4 peers and instantly get booted down to this single peer. deleted peers.dat and removed 91.230.123.101 from conf file. im now stuck at 251737 with the chainz hash showing as invalid :/ 2015-11-22 20:37:53 InvalidChainFound: invalid block=001208333b6ca7e1ca9955825f3dac3ac5bebbdd210fe262e70f27a167f02a4b height=251738 log2_work=35.94582 date=2015-11-22 19:04:34 tried sync again. stuck now for good 2015-11-22 20:52:58 UpdateTip: new best=0006eb215fe3f81487ee2671f1758f3be2a6896e25c0fd70e976d66d23154e75 height=251737 log2_work=35.94582 tx=260965 date=2015-11-22 19:04:15 progress=0.999303 cache=12 2015-11-22 20:52:58 ERROR: ConnectBlock(): banknode miningkey invalid 2015-11-22 20:52:58 InvalidChainFound: invalid block=001208333b6ca7e1ca9955825f3dac3ac5bebbdd210fe262e70f27a167f02a4b height=251738 log2_work=35.94582 date=2015-11-22 19:04:34 2015-11-22 20:52:58 InvalidChainFound: current best=0006eb215fe3f81487ee2671f1758f3be2a6896e25c0fd70e976d66d23154e75 height=251737 log2_work=35.94582 date=2015-11-22 19:04:15 2015-11-22 20:52:58 ERROR: ConnectTip(): ConnectBlock 001208333b6ca7e1ca9955825f3dac3ac5bebbdd210fe262e70f27a167f02a4b failed 2015-11-22 20:52:58 InvalidChainFound: invalid block=001208333b6ca7e1ca9955825f3dac3ac5bebbdd210fe262e70f27a167f02a4b height=251738 log2_work=35.94582 date=2015-11-22 19:04:34 2015-11-22 20:52:58 InvalidChainFound: current best=0006eb215fe3f81487ee2671f1758f3be2a6896e25c0fd70e976d66d23154e75 height=251737 log2_work=35.94582 date=2015-11-22 19:04:15 2015-11-22 20:52:58 ERROR: AcceptBlockHeader : block is marked invalid 2015-11-22 20:52:58 ERROR: invalid header received maybe 251737 is the issue as it replies with mining key invalid but processes the block, and the next one becomes an invalid block and the fork starts there. it should have thrown out block 251737? or im reading it wrong. either way my client bans all its peers for giving it invalid blocks and connections goes to zero.
|
$MAID & $BTC other than that some short hodls and some long held garbage.
|
|
|
proletariat
Legendary
Offline
Activity: 1246
Merit: 1005
|
|
November 22, 2015, 08:38:42 PM |
|
okay what the fuck.. third time i did this.. i completely emptied the data folder.. added all the available nodes from the blockexplorer in my bitcredit.conf.. did a full resync of my wallet.. again stuck on block 236433!! well....you expect a difference while connecting to bad nodes? There is nothing the dev can do about cutting them off save for an upgrade. Try using the --connect flag with a synced node. I tried three times now. 1st with no addnodes, 2nd with addnodes from chainz, 3rd with connect..... every time it gets stuck on 236433. multiple hours for each try while it tries to sync.. https://chainz.cryptoid.info/bcr/masternodes.dws^^ I asked months back how localhost banknodes are possible.... no reply. there's 45 of them.... **EDIT** A current bootstrap would be appreciated
|
|
|
|
hack_
|
|
November 22, 2015, 09:41:57 PM |
|
maybe 251737 is the issue as it replies with mining key invalid but processes the block, and the next one becomes an invalid block and the fork starts there. it should have thrown out block 251737? or im reading it wrong. either way my client bans all its peers for giving it invalid blocks and connections goes to zero.
Ah, yeah we discussed this issue , the update to the balances file is happening in the connect tip function, after block is already connected which creates a strange condition. we have a planned fix, should resolve that. This mostly happens when a wallet just emptied to 50K and mines a block, you can see what happened on the block explorer. I'll try upload you a bootstrap and get the dev to just push that single fix to the git. (not sure how long uploading bstrap will take, i'm in an airport lounge)
|
|
|
|
hack_
|
|
November 22, 2015, 09:44:50 PM |
|
okay what the fuck.. third time i did this.. i completely emptied the data folder.. added all the available nodes from the blockexplorer in my bitcredit.conf.. did a full resync of my wallet.. again stuck on block 236433!! well....you expect a difference while connecting to bad nodes? There is nothing the dev can do about cutting them off save for an upgrade. Try using the --connect flag with a synced node. I tried three times now. 1st with no addnodes, 2nd with addnodes from chainz, 3rd with connect..... every time it gets stuck on 236433. multiple hours for each try while it tries to sync.. https://chainz.cryptoid.info/bcr/masternodes.dws^^ I asked months back how localhost banknodes are possible.... no reply. there's 45 of them.... **EDIT** A current bootstrap would be appreciated Local nodes...dead simple: Set Bnaddr to 127.0.0.1:xxxx with xxxx being the rpc port for that instance, then start the bn. Boostrap: coming soon (ban net link where i am ryt now)
|
|
|
|
jasemoney
Legendary
Offline
Activity: 1610
Merit: 1008
Forget-about-it
|
|
November 22, 2015, 10:07:02 PM |
|
Thanks very much hack_
|
$MAID & $BTC other than that some short hodls and some long held garbage.
|
|
|
bitcreditscc (OP)
|
|
November 22, 2015, 10:23:37 PM |
|
lol, @ hack_ still stuck there? jus take a bus Ok, since i have a faster connection, i am also trying to upload a b-strap. If you guys don't mind.... can we just work off the b-strap? It's getting harder to keep track of changes commited over vcarious branches and i don't want to risk leaving something critical out. rc out in a couple of days, no p2p lending, but fixes and working new Db and dummy p2plending so we can discuss before making it active. Blacklisting is giving me a headache.
|
|
|
|
proletariat
Legendary
Offline
Activity: 1246
Merit: 1005
|
|
November 22, 2015, 10:36:43 PM |
|
okay what the fuck.. third time i did this.. i completely emptied the data folder.. added all the available nodes from the blockexplorer in my bitcredit.conf.. did a full resync of my wallet.. again stuck on block 236433!! well....you expect a difference while connecting to bad nodes? There is nothing the dev can do about cutting them off save for an upgrade. Try using the --connect flag with a synced node. I tried three times now. 1st with no addnodes, 2nd with addnodes from chainz, 3rd with connect..... every time it gets stuck on 236433. multiple hours for each try while it tries to sync.. https://chainz.cryptoid.info/bcr/masternodes.dws^^ I asked months back how localhost banknodes are possible.... no reply. there's 45 of them.... **EDIT** A current bootstrap would be appreciated Local nodes...dead simple: Set Bnaddr to 127.0.0.1:xxxx with xxxx being the rpc port for that instance, then start the bn. Boostrap: coming soon (ban net link where i am ryt now) Thanks. About the localhost nodes: I thought BN would provide a service or similar - how can the bcr network ban or target those for connections or whatever when needed when you don't know the ip?
|
|
|
|
hack_
|
|
November 22, 2015, 10:44:34 PM |
|
Thanks.
About the localhost nodes: I thought BN would provide a service or similar - how can the bcr network ban or target those for connections or whatever when needed when you don't know the ip?
Well.... i guess i could answer by asking.....so how do TOR BNs provide services then? What we are mostly concerned with for now is the ChainID, that is what holds the funds, so nomatter clearnet, or otherwise, so long as it is online and providing financial service. We ban/blacklist an address, IPs don't seem improtant to the dev.
|
|
|
|
|
proletariat
Legendary
Offline
Activity: 1246
Merit: 1005
|
|
November 22, 2015, 10:57:05 PM |
|
Thanks.
About the localhost nodes: I thought BN would provide a service or similar - how can the bcr network ban or target those for connections or whatever when needed when you don't know the ip?
Well.... i guess i could answer by asking.....so how do TOR BNs provide services then? What we are mostly concerned with for now is the ChainID, that is what holds the funds, so nomatter clearnet, or otherwise, so long as it is online and providing financial service. We ban/blacklist an address, IPs don't seem improtant to the dev. I see. makes sense to target the address. Still caught my attention though since whenever i did that in other coins, my locahost nodes connection would drop, I mean the network would see them but it either banned me or I would lose the connection somehow after a couple of minutes... unless I used it with my proper IP. I like it though, for its err privacy? All set! thanks a lot.
|
|
|
|
proletariat
Legendary
Offline
Activity: 1246
Merit: 1005
|
|
November 22, 2015, 11:08:10 PM |
|
****FORGOT TO MENTION*****
I used electrum.... maybe that's why?
Please make sure the priv key you are importing is the one for that specific address. I haven't tried electrum, but if the priv key is in a different format , you'll need to convert it. I'll take a look as well. Can you post the address Bitcredit gives you after you import the key? The coins were definitely sent. well that's the thing.. it's not like other wallets.. I have no clue where to see my receiving address and I've clicked everything.... Well if the key is correct , you still have to convert it , hence the link, i think i say some code to get the key. For the mean time, i'd encourage you to use the format that can be imported into any wallet. Eventually i'll write code that will allow you to import other variants of keys.....but as you know, the todo list is ever expanding er... yeah electrum's privkey is the same formatting as in other btc wallets according to some reply i got on the post above, and you can import them into any other wallet according to him. But yeah don't worry about my issue right now, I'll consider it cold storage for the time being. very very strange. I have millions of bitcoin keys and they all start with 5. The issue is the key's format. But it's all good, just don't loose the key. Guess i was right :- https://en.bitcoin.it/wiki/Wallet_import_formatSo ... now fully synced my coins are there! I got paid! I guess i had done everything right but I was probably on a fork at that time... I had not tried again until today.... very very nice. the btc bidding address in the qt, is it up to date? I'd like to bid again.
|
|
|
|
hack_
|
|
November 22, 2015, 11:12:43 PM |
|
****FORGOT TO MENTION*****
I used electrum.... maybe that's why?
Please make sure the priv key you are importing is the one for that specific address. I haven't tried electrum, but if the priv key is in a different format , you'll need to convert it. I'll take a look as well. Can you post the address Bitcredit gives you after you import the key? The coins were definitely sent. well that's the thing.. it's not like other wallets.. I have no clue where to see my receiving address and I've clicked everything.... Well if the key is correct , you still have to convert it , hence the link, i think i say some code to get the key. For the mean time, i'd encourage you to use the format that can be imported into any wallet. Eventually i'll write code that will allow you to import other variants of keys.....but as you know, the todo list is ever expanding er... yeah electrum's privkey is the same formatting as in other btc wallets according to some reply i got on the post above, and you can import them into any other wallet according to him. But yeah don't worry about my issue right now, I'll consider it cold storage for the time being. very very strange. I have millions of bitcoin keys and they all start with 5. The issue is the key's format. But it's all good, just don't loose the key. Guess i was right :- https://en.bitcoin.it/wiki/Wallet_import_formatSo ... now fully synced my coins are there! I got paid! I guess i had done everything right but I was probably on a fork at that time... I had not tried again until today.... very very nice. the btc bidding address in the qt, is it up to date? I'd like to bid again. Great, current bid address starts is 1BCRbid2i3wbgqrKtgLGem6ZchcfYbnhNu I try to make one bid a day, but my BTC is stuck, hopefull i can get it before today's block.
|
|
|
|
|
dragos_bdi
|
|
November 23, 2015, 07:30:24 AM Last edit: November 23, 2015, 08:51:50 AM by dragos_bdi |
|
|
Thank You for your tips! BCR - 5u7KPyiHKeg6sbdvd9XhT9HHpvh5c2ppTe BTC - 1ASJQ7SE84sgQketS2kQCTQLV3DJesYnLh
|
|
|
MbccompanyX
Full Member
Offline
Activity: 182
Merit: 100
★YoBit.Net★ 350+ Coins Exchange & Dice
|
|
November 23, 2015, 07:35:12 AM |
|
1. you noticed there is already another link for the bootstrap and is just some post before of your? 2. i suggest you make at least a mirror link of the file on some other website because if mega goes down (ex: maintenance) downloading the bootstrap will be impossible
|
|
|
|
dragos_bdi
|
|
November 23, 2015, 07:44:37 AM Last edit: November 23, 2015, 08:52:15 AM by dragos_bdi |
|
2. i suggest you make at least a mirror link of the file on some other website because if mega goes down (ex: maintenance) downloading the bootstrap will be impossible Bitcredit252117.7z - 186MB http://bitcredits.pw/downloads/win/Bitcredit252117.7z
|
Thank You for your tips! BCR - 5u7KPyiHKeg6sbdvd9XhT9HHpvh5c2ppTe BTC - 1ASJQ7SE84sgQketS2kQCTQLV3DJesYnLh
|
|
|
MbccompanyX
Full Member
Offline
Activity: 182
Merit: 100
★YoBit.Net★ 350+ Coins Exchange & Dice
|
|
November 23, 2015, 08:06:52 AM |
|
1. i don't think that posting the whole blockchain on the ufficial website could be considered mirror 2. how much is the size at the moment? (i'm on the phone so i can't check well some websites)
|
|
|
|
dragos_bdi
|
|
November 23, 2015, 08:53:52 AM |
|
1. i don't think that posting the whole blockchain on the ufficial website could be considered mirror 2. how much is the size at the moment? (i'm on the phone so i can't check well some websites)
1. it's not the official website 2. I've updated the posts, it's 186MB archived Nothing stops you to mirror elsewhere.
|
Thank You for your tips! BCR - 5u7KPyiHKeg6sbdvd9XhT9HHpvh5c2ppTe BTC - 1ASJQ7SE84sgQketS2kQCTQLV3DJesYnLh
|
|
|
|